Overall Satisfaction with Dropbox

We use Dropbox to share key documents, meeting recordings and product videos between teams at our business. It helps to store larger files, rather than trying to embed them in Notion, Slack or other tools. We can easily link to media stored there without slowing down page load speeds, etc.

Uploading larger files and media items to be shared among teams.
Storing and housing materials that need to be access by internal or external partners.

Less successful - collaboration. This feels easier in tools like Notion and Confluence.
